is three over five rational or irrational

Answers

GPT-4o mini
Three over five, or \( \frac{3}{5} \), is a rational number. Rational numbers are defined as numbers that can be expressed as a fraction \( \frac{a}{b} \), where \( a \) and \( b \) are integers and \( b \) is not zero. Since both 3 and 5 are integers, and 5 is not zero, \( \frac{3}{5} \) is indeed rational.
